Mountain bike trails around Brewster, Massachusetts, traverse diverse natural landscapes, including extensive protected woodlands and numerous freshwater ponds. The region is characterized by its relatively flat terrain, with gentle elevation changes, making it accessible for various skill levels. Nickerson State Park, a prominent 1,900-acre area, offers a network of trails through dense forests and around its many lakes. Over one-third of Brewster's land is dedicated to conservation, providing ample opportunities for off-road cycling.

Best mountain bike trails around Brewster

  • The most popular mountain bike trail is Nickerson State Park – Cliff Pond loop from East Harwich, a 17.9 miles (28.8 km) trail that takes 2 hours 16 minutes to complete. This moderate route explores the varied terrain within Nickerson State Park.
  • Another top favourite among local mountain bikers is Cliff Pond – Nickerson State Park loop from Flax Pond, a moderate 22.5 miles (36.3 km) path. This route offers extensive riding through the park's woodlands and past its freshwater bodies.
  • Local mountain bikers also love the Nickerson State Park – Cliff Pond loop from Brewster, a 21.7 miles (35.0 km) trail leading through dense woodlands and alongside ponds, often completed in about 2 hours 34 minutes.

Coast Guard Beach is located in Eastham, Massachusetts, and is one of Cape Cod National Seashore’s most popular destinations. Known for its stunning views and expansive sandy shores, it is a favorite among locals and visitors for swimming, sunbathing, and surfing. Visitors can enjoy birdwatching and explore the nearby Nauset Marsh Trail. During the summer, shuttle services provide access from the Salt Marsh Visitor Center due to limited parking.

Coast Guard Beach is a popular swimming beach during the summer season. Further south along the coast is Nauset Spit, where the ocean water flows into the Nauset Marsh during the tides. This is where writer Henry Beston lived in a beach house when he wrote The Outermost House in 1928. The book describes life on the beach in detail during the four seasons. https://www.nps.gov/caco/planyourvisit/coast-guard-beach-eastham.htm

Frequently Asked Questions

How many mountain bike trails are there in Brewster?

Brewster offers a selection of mountain bike trails, with over 10 routes available for exploration. These trails traverse diverse natural landscapes, including dense woodlands and freshwater ponds.

Are there easy mountain bike trails in Brewster suitable for beginners?

Yes, Brewster has several easy mountain bike trails. For instance, the Rafe's Pond Property loop from Nickerson State Park is an easy 16.6 km route, and the Little Cliff Pond Beach – Nickerson State Park loop from Nickerson State Park is another accessible option at 18.5 km.

Are there family-friendly mountain bike trails in Brewster?

Many of the trails in Brewster, particularly those within Nickerson State Park, are suitable for families due to the region's relatively flat terrain and gentle elevation changes. The easy-rated trails are generally a good choice for family outings.

Can I bring my dog on the mountain bike trails in Brewster?

Many conservation areas and state parks in Massachusetts, including Nickerson State Park, generally allow dogs on trails, often requiring them to be on a leash. It's always best to check specific park regulations before you go to ensure a smooth ride with your canine companion.

What is the typical duration of mountain bike rides in Brewster?

Mountain bike rides in Brewster vary in duration depending on the trail and your pace. Moderate routes like the Nickerson State Park – Cliff Pond loop from East Harwich can take around 2 hours 16 minutes, while longer moderate loops might extend to 2.5 to 3 hours.

Where can I find parking for mountain bike trails in Brewster?

Nickerson State Park is a primary hub for mountain biking in Brewster and offers designated parking areas for trail access. Other conservation areas throughout the town also typically provide parking at their trailheads.

Are there mountain bike loop trails available in Brewster?

Yes, Brewster is known for its loop trails, especially within Nickerson State Park. Many routes, such as the Cliff Pond – Nickerson State Park loop from Flax Pond, are designed as loops, allowing you to start and end at the same point.

Do the mountain bike trails in Brewster offer scenic viewpoints?

While Brewster's terrain is generally flat, the trails offer scenic views of its diverse natural features. You'll ride through dense woodlands and alongside numerous freshwater ponds like Cliff Pond, providing picturesque natural vistas rather than elevated panoramic viewpoints.

What kind of wildlife might I encounter on the trails?

Brewster's protected woodlands and conservation areas are home to various wildlife. Riders might spot white-tailed deer, various bird species, and smaller mammals. The freshwater ponds also attract waterfowl and other aquatic life.

What is the best time of year for mountain biking in Brewster?

The spring and fall seasons generally offer the most pleasant conditions for mountain biking in Brewster, with cooler temperatures and vibrant foliage. Summer can also be enjoyable, though it can be warmer and more humid.

How are the mountain bike trail conditions typically in Brewster?

The mountain bike trails in Brewster, particularly within Nickerson State Park and other conservation areas, are generally well-maintained. Conditions can vary with weather, with trails potentially being muddy after rain. The sandy soil characteristic of Cape Cod can also influence trail surfaces.

Is winter mountain biking possible in Brewster?

Winter mountain biking in Brewster is possible, though conditions depend heavily on snow and ice. Trails may be rideable on colder, dry days, but snow cover can make some routes challenging or impassable. Always check local conditions before heading out.
